v2.8.3 — Fixed session-token refresh bug in Bramblegate. Tokens refreshed during an active request were occasionally invalidated, forcing users to re-authenticate mid-session. Root cause: race between the refresh worker and the cache evictor. Support: affected users on 2.8.0–2.8.2 should clear stored sessions once after upgrading; no further action needed. Escalate any recurrence to the engineer responsible for this fix, named below.

named custodian: Belius Casath Ulaix Sorius

// Loyalty-points ledger client (Pointward)
//
// This client talks to the Pointward ledger service for all accrual
// and redemption writes. On-call notes: writes are idempotent via the
// request hash, so retries are safe. If the ledger returns 503, back
// off 30s — do NOT failover to the replica, it is read-only and will
// silently drop accruals. Timeouts are set deliberately high because
// batch reconciliation runs nightly. Auth is a static key loaded at
// startup; the current staging key is below.

service key, fawip-bajef: kto11_Qt5wZK9vdNC

For heads of department. After eighteen months of declining margins, the board has approved preliminary steps toward selling the Marnell Coatings unit. Advisors from Helvane Partners are preparing valuation materials, and staff consultations begin next month under regional guidelines. Department heads should identify shared services dependencies and report transition risks by the twentieth. Customer commitments remain unaffected during the process. Please review the confidential planning note appended directly below.

board note of bawep-tajef: Queniusek Systems plans to raise the Quenvan list price by 53.1 percent in March. The pricing group signed off on a budget of $176.4 million for Project Drueth. The renewal with Casionix Partners closes at $142.5 million a year, 8.3 percent below the last contract. Project Fraax slips by six weeks because of the tooling delay.

Changelog v2.8.1 — QueryWeave N+1 fix. For new folks: the resolver batcher that eliminates N+1 queries was previously gated by WEAVE_BATCH_MODE; that setting is now renamed WEAVE_LOADER_MODE and the old name is ignored. The batcher also now requires the metrics sink credential at startup rather than lazily. Update your .env by adding the following line under WEAVE_LOADER_MODE:

env line for kahof-yahag: RELAY_SECRET5=224bf